Course Content

• Introduction to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) and Accountability
• Environmental Legislation and Regulations (National and International)
• EIA Methodologies and Best Practices
• Environmental Impact Assessment: Scoping and Baseline Studies
• Impact Prediction and Assessment Techniques
• Mitigation and Compensation Strategies
• Environmental Monitoring and Auditing
• Public Participation and Stakeholder Engagement in EIA
• Reporting and Communication of EIA Findings
• Environmental Impact Assessment and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R)

Career path

Career Role Description
Environmental Consultant (EIA Specialist) Conducting Environmental Impact Assessments, advising clients on environmental regulations, and mitigating environmental risks. High demand for expertise in UK infrastructure projects.
Sustainability Manager (Environmental Impact Assessment) Developing and implementing sustainability strategies, overseeing EIA processes, ensuring compliance with environmental regulations within organizations. Growing sector with increasing emphasis on corporate social responsibility.
Environmental Impact Assessment Officer (Planning & Development) Evaluating the environmental impacts of proposed developments, preparing EIA reports, liaising with stakeholders and regulatory bodies. Crucial role in the UK's planning and development landscape.
Environmental Auditor (EIA Compliance) Auditing organizations for EIA compliance, identifying areas for improvement and providing recommendations. Essential for ensuring environmental accountability within businesses.
